摘要

在当前中国国民经济中,汽车制造业已是身兼重任的支柱产业,是中国经济发展

“风向标”。可惜的是,目前在国内市场上大行其道的依旧是来自传统汽车强国的合

资品牌。国内汽车制造企业在近年来的发展反而举步维艰,造成这一现状的原因有很

多,其中很重要一个原因就是我们缺乏核心技术研发能力,尤其是关键零部件制造开

发技术。

纵观当下总体形势,中国制造业时下已到了转型的关键时期。如何从制造大国突破

转型为“智“造强国,如何使我们的产品摆脱低端的劳动力及原材料竞争,真正在全

球高端制造市场大展宏图。及早探索出一套适合中国汽车制造业的项目幵发风险管理

能力是我们正面临的一个重大挑战。由此,针对项目风险管理在汽车新零部件开发的

应用的研究不仅对外资巨头有重大的现实和战略意义,更是对中国本土零部件厂商有

着十分重要的借鉴意义。

本文将通过研究项目风险的评估方法,项目的专题风险识别,风险源故障树分析等

来介绍一个汽车发动机正时系统零部件的应用开发项目。

关键词:汽车零部件;项目管理;风险评估
